ABOUT KID HARPOON

English singer, songwriter, and producer who has won critical acclaim with solo singles like "Rivertime" and "It's Time." He has had a hand in the writing of songs by a number of big-name artists, including "Sweet Creature" by Harry Styles and "Roses" by Shawn Mendes . In 2023, he received a Grammy award for his work as a producer on the Harry Styles album Harry's House.

He was raised in Chatham, Kent, England. He got his start in the mid-2000s as a regular performer at the music venue Nambucca.

His writing on Florence + The Machine's "Shake It Out" earned him an Ivor Novello Award nomination. He released one solo album in 2009, titled Once.

His real name is Tom Hull. He married Jenny Myles, with whom he has a daughter named Lullah.

He co-wrote Calvin Harris ' chart-topping single "Sweet Nothing."
